The Rock & Roll Hall of Fame member has returned to the stage this year and embarked on an international tour. Art Garfunkel will bring his two-man show and do a live set that encompasses his solo hits, Simon and Garfunkel songs, cuts from his favorite songwriters, parts of his book and a Q & A. To find out more about this amazing artist visit www.artgarfunkel.com where he chronicles in order, every book he has read since 1968, his 60 favorite songs of all time, poetry and discography. Singer Art Garfunkel says, “I am pleased to do this benefit evening for Human Development Services of Westchester, I support the important work they are doing in the community.” HDSW’s Executive Director, Andrea Kocsis, adds, “We are truly grateful to Art Garfunkel for working with us to benefit those we serve. HDSW is dedicated to empowering the individuals and families we serve to achieve self-sufficiency. The mission of HDSW is accomplished through the provision of housing, vocational services, care management, community support and health and mental health rehabilitation services. HDSW also cooperates and collaborates with concerned individuals and organizations in community education and advocacy activities. HDSW has been serving the Westchester area since 1968 and helps over 2500 men, women and children each year. End
